





Keshan Carpet 95x60
250.00 €
Delivery time within Germany: 2 - 3 days
Delivery time within EU: 3 - 5 days
Delivery time within EU: 3 - 5 days
Free shipping on orders over €50
Express delivery in 2-3 business days
Secure payment options

Keschan Carpet 218x134
From2950.00 €

Keshan Carpet 222x142
From2750.00 €

Kashan Carpet 317x194
From1400.00 €

Yazd Carpet 367x267
From1850.00 €

KESHAN Carpet 297x198
From999.00 €

KESHAN Carpet 309x207
From950.00 €

Antique Kashan Carpet 213x138
From2950.00 €

Keshan Antique Carpet 196x130
From2550.00 €